AICon上海|与字节、阿里、腾讯等企业共同探索Agent 时代的落地应用 了解详情
写点什么

从 Silverlight 访问 Windows 7 的特性

  • 2011-01-22
  • 本文字数:942 字

    阅读完需:约 3 分钟

最近微软发布了暴露 Windows 7 特性的程序库,包括传感器、语音、设备、任务条、触控技术等,这个程序库是为带有更高级别信任关系的运行在浏览器之外的Silverlight 应用程序所用的。

Silverlight 最初只想要运行在浏览器中,并且由于安全性的原因,只能对系统资源进行有限的访问。 之后,微软引入了浏览器之外(Out-of-Browser OOB) 特性,让Silverlight 应用程序能够在浏览器的沙盒之外运行,但还是有些限制。 Silverlight 4 中增加了 COM+ 自动控制,这让 Silverlight 的 OOB 应用程序能够使用具有 COM 功能的 API 来访问 Windows 组件。 这个特性是特别为需要更高级别信任关系的企业客户引入的。 问题是,并非所有 Windows 组件都支持 COM,所以从 Silverlight 还是无法访问所有组件。

针对微软 Silverlight 的本地扩展(Native Extensions for Microsoft Silverlight NESL)是向 Silverlight 应用程序暴露 Windows 7 特性的组件库。 微软在去年 12 月份发布了 1.0 版本,其中提供了对下列组件的支持:

一个月之后,微软发布了 NESL 2.0 的预览版本,添加了对多点触控的支持、演示程序、以及对 1.0 版本的缺陷修正。在该程序库的未来版本中还会添加更多的特性。

这个程序库只能在 32 位或者 64 位的 Windows 7 上运行,并且只能被运行在更高级别信任关系下的 OOB Silverlight 应用程序使用。 其它版本的 Windows 和 Mac OS X 上都不支持 NESL。这个代码是基于微软代码共享许可发布的。

相关信息: 自动控制(OLE 自动控制)——关于在Windows 中使用自动控制的一般信息,彻底了解Silverlight 4 自动控制——在Silverlight 中使用自动控制的示例。

查看英文原文: Accessing Windows 7 Features from Silverlight

2011-01-22 19:221617
用户头像

发布了 340 篇内容, 共 135.3 次阅读, 收获喜欢 13 次。

关注

评论

发布
暂无评论
发现更多内容

事业-最佳实践-编码-提升代码可复用性

南山

代码质量 轮子 可复用性 代码复用

【云计算小知识】云管理的作用是什么?

行云管家

云计算 数据安全 数据备份 云管理

怎么查询游戏服务器IP?哪些工具可以协助?

一只扑棱蛾子

服务器

产品经理必备的API技术知识

幂简集成

产品经理 API

IDC 权威认可!Aloudata 入选金融领域中数据管理分析服务最佳实践案例

Aloudata

数据分析 自动化 IDC 全链路数据血缘 金融数据

测试人员都是画画大神,让我看看谁还不会用代码图?

禅道项目管理

软件测试 开发人员 测试人员 代码图

国内优质堡垒机厂商大揭秘!你知多少!

行云管家

网络安全 数据安全 堡垒机

个人品牌升级攻略:ChatGPT助您塑造独特简历风格

测吧(北京)科技有限公司

测试

什么? 20分钟,构建你自己的LLaMA3应用程序| 京东云技术团队

京东科技开发者

怪兽AI数字人直播软件

Mr_song

AI 短视频 直播 数字人

聚焦OLAP性能提升,火山引擎ByteHouse性能挑战赛圆满落幕

字节跳动数据平台

Java Chassis 3:接口维度负载均衡

华为云开发者联盟

Java 华为云 华为云开发者联盟 企业号2024年5月PK榜

如何优雅的使用ollama| 京东云技术团队

京东科技开发者

电商后台的秘密:通过API接口提取商品信息

Noah

英特尔人工智能创新应用大赛最终奖项揭晓!酷睿Ultra助力选手创意开发

E科讯

OSS_PIPE:Rust编写的大规模文件迁移工具

京东科技开发者

10分钟了解Flink SQL使用

不在线第一只蜗牛

sql 大数据 flink

外贸网站优化为什么要布置内部链接?如何优化内链?

九凌网络

从Silverlight访问Windows 7的特性_.NET_Abel Avram_InfoQ精选文章